Benefits of Sofa Fabric
Stain-Resistant:
A popular cited con of fabric sofas is that it is very absorbent. However innovations in technology have ensured that the new fabric sofas are stain-resistant and low on maintenance.
Rub and Tear Resistant:
Fabric is often preferred over leather or Microfiber for being rub and tear resistant. Since fabrics are woven together therefore they are more durable and make excellent value for money.
The fabric is made by combining natural and man-made fibers; these offer more strength and can withstand wear and tear. Thus these make excellent choice as family sofas, whether as sectional sofas or modern medieval sofas. Go pets? Unless you have the sofas with top-grain leather, the fabric sofas are always a better option.
They Don’t Absorb Heat:
Unlike leather which is porous, fabric does not absorb heat and become sticky or become cold. This comes as an excellent choice and hold well especially for those living in areas that experience extreme temperatures.
